|
|
|
|
|
для: igla
(01.06.2011 в 10:29)
| | Хм... странно, а если вам числа нужны, зачем вы тогда круглые скобки применяете к квадратным, а не к числам? У вас работающее регулярное выражение, осталось только числа взять.
<?php
$text = 'Нужна помощь в составлении регулярки для
такого выражения <[24,56];data=текст1,date2=текст2>';
$pattern = "#<\[([0-9]{1,11}),([0-9]{1,11})\];(.*)>#";
if(preg_match($pattern, $text, $out)) echo $out[1].",".$out[2];
?>
|
| |
|
|
|
|
|
|
| Всем добрый день!
Нужна помощь в составлении регулярки для такого выражения <[24,56];data=текст1,date2=текст2>
Так не работает
#<(\[)[0-9]{1,11},[0-9]{1,11}(\]);(.*)>#
|
Вообщем нужно вытащить числа 24, 56 и параметры(date,date2) со значениями (текст1, текст2) как в примере. | |
|
|
|
|